Transaction 75f21126747e50b26e4dff47d602c85f1925e4264c5690588978f180a730e4ca

3 Input
2 Outputs
  • 75f21126747e50b26e4dff47d602c85f1925e4264c5690588978f180a730e4ca:0
  • value  35000000
    address  3C8Az1W8byxqsPmBcbrz97fvr76Jd8Nkkr
  • 75f21126747e50b26e4dff47d602c85f1925e4264c5690588978f180a730e4ca:1
  • value  824286
    address  1Q57v5pnVxGDmYkctQVK9hGcNxG4Vbqv4Y